To select several areas of an image and keep them all selected, follow
these steps:
1
Select one area of the image.
2
Hold down the Shift key and select the next area.
You can choose a different Selection tool if you wish. The second selection
may overlap the first selection.
3
Repeat step 2 as many times as you need to.
A moving dashed line surrounds the currently selected areas. If you use
an Action tool anywhere within a selected area, the action affects all the
selected areas.
Subtracting from a selection
After you’ve selected an area, you can use the x key to subtract from the
selection. Follow these steps:
1
Select one part of the image.
2
Hold down the x key and select another area that overlaps your first selection.
